summ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Tomas Chvatal <scarabeus@gentoo.org>2010-02-03 16:08:05 +0000
committerTomas Chvatal <scarabeus@gentoo.org>2010-02-03 16:08:05 +0000
commit6cb4bd335899419771d1bae820478e4991899256 (patch)
treec8293bb13dba1b1271dd4a417b8dee47c29cb1ed /dev-libs
parentBump dbus, add 2 patches from upstream, one to fix a compilation issue (diff)
downloadhistorical-6cb4bd335899419771d1bae820478e4991899256.tar.gz
historical-6cb4bd335899419771d1bae820478e4991899256.tar.bz2
historical-6cb4bd335899419771d1bae820478e4991899256.zip
Fix automagic cddb again. And it looks this time it is in upstream repo.
Package-Manager: portage-2.2_rc62/cvs/Linux x86_64
Diffstat (limited to 'dev-libs')
-rw-r--r--dev-libs/libcdio/ChangeLog7
-rw-r--r--dev-libs/libcdio/Manifest12
-rw-r--r--dev-libs/libcdio/libcdio-0.82.ebuild29
3 files changed, 24 insertions, 24 deletions
diff --git a/dev-libs/libcdio/ChangeLog b/dev-libs/libcdio/ChangeLog
index 61da22c0f1f9..1511331e14a0 100644
--- a/dev-libs/libcdio/ChangeLog
+++ b/dev-libs/libcdio/ChangeLog
@@ -1,6 +1,9 @@
# ChangeLog for dev-libs/libcdio
-#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/libcdio/ChangeLog,v 1.111 2009/10/27 15:08:31 flameeyes Exp $
+#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/libcdio/ChangeLog,v 1.112 2010/02/03 16:08:05 scarabeus Exp $
+
+ 03 Feb 2010; Tomáš Chvátal <scarabeus@gentoo.org> libcdio-0.82.ebuild:
+ Fix automagic cddb again. And it looks this time it is in upstream repo.
27 Oct 2009; Diego E. Pettenò <flameeyes@gentoo.org> metadata.xml:
Give up maintainership.
diff --git a/dev-libs/libcdio/Manifest b/dev-libs/libcdio/Manifest
index f4acc338214a..0fe443ee3612 100644
--- a/dev-libs/libcdio/Manifest
+++ b/dev-libs/libcdio/Manifest
@@ -9,13 +9,13 @@ DIST libcdio-0.80.tar.gz 2083287 RMD160 3ca404bffb107ad950505b8ccd9e659e306545cb
DIST libcdio-0.82.tar.gz 2240599 RMD160 48dc71f349235ab501985a296fd3deee295c167f SHA1 b3a87283a373eed816c15584c373ad6d2f95f09a SHA256 1acb3de8e0927906ade7a34c5853173d3068b87b02dfba80d0bf11e47f0b5d39
EBUILD libcdio-0.80-r1.ebuild 2221 RMD160 6373938e31ba7aefa64524557015b84ff34b6cfd SHA1 39b9381dea3fa958e25ef1c3631d1e7c340f1590 SHA256 1bb5fdfb01b60919d921cc3b94a89f738e663b6bd0046573f82b34f52e18414f
EBUILD libcdio-0.80.ebuild 2161 RMD160 87d8aefb06062b24cc5b4c1dae13b296ee6958ac SHA1 8bdd42cc6336559f679bacf57a54c613de98830f SHA256 b5cae44ece39ecf25ec1cd4b71738c211726a228720bb4f89957f19e4c663618
-EBUILD libcdio-0.82.ebuild 1647 RMD160 c75fa0ba5728e020717a21a4a9fd55012dc9563a SHA1 77e226039f3a8e5de7f824c51504b0a4e7260c83 SHA256 3dbf809c714c6411c0a7cd8960a35381d2c5db545027476b0ad1f716550ca821
-MISC ChangeLog 15917 RMD160 0f4402bf927171bd0423d7ee77a089bc1b264a85 SHA1 cb1afef195b03556bfb2459c38d3cab97f4cb28a SHA256 a560a42bf94912ee6f4fed1d2d5bfeb6549207e6ba7e6c568d662d41c73a93cb
+EBUILD libcdio-0.82.ebuild 1580 RMD160 321e3f541a04f6c5dc99bf13259404aac5212a4c SHA1 09ffe6cb078418d5b9b752937b187f30b3850929 SHA256 404eb3abf7df2c16bddb25493d768579f28a3121a8e7500a84aca86237885300
+MISC ChangeLog 16069 RMD160 0cf273fa15b0d11f3c068b680c1735290d57d31f SHA1 d9bd51284f160e9fdf05fce92e3d763e089ccf14 SHA256 6e7898864f869d4f97f6f26c6d0f0d360e84dbb401ea1366d26d014ee6e37403
MISC metadata.xml 422 RMD160 157ce766b850a7bdd941a3e629258265e22501e8 SHA1 b7e40367ad2bab50ec3448e9a223a34bb6c45092 SHA256 07686b4cc783be22b54d0c85d2112dc0b9815d0fb71792e1d7410aa66c05f459
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.13 (GNU/Linux)
+Version: GnuPG v2.0.14 (GNU/Linux)
-iEYEARECAAYFAkrnDQYACgkQAiZjviIA2XjqVgCfRwADL3uIc/k5NyN9nRJFVFP1
-Wm4AoNA/xPmlBmK5/sGJa+6bB5zY9BNi
-=P/Rs
+iEYEARECAAYFAktpnzwACgkQHB6c3gNBRYeZ8ACeJAKV8CvqH685laHf812BrPC9
+vMYAoKrv7Y1tgUG86HR9RE/mirZmCU/o
+=ja2A
-----END PGP SIGNATURE-----
diff --git a/dev-libs/libcdio/libcdio-0.82.ebuild b/dev-libs/libcdio/libcdio-0.82.ebuild
index 3f7fb27d06e4..f23934801ebc 100644
--- a/dev-libs/libcdio/libcdio-0.82.ebuild
+++ b/dev-libs/libcdio/libcdio-0.82.ebuild
@@ -1,10 +1,10 @@
-# Copyright 1999-2009 Gentoo Foundation
+#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-libs/libcdio/libcdio-0.82.ebuild,v 1.1 2009/10/27 15:08:00 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-libs/libcdio/libcdio-0.82.ebuild,v 1.2 2010/02/03 16:08:05 scarabeus Exp $
-EAPI=1
+EAPI=2
-inherit eutils libtool multilib autotools
+inherit eutils libtool multilib autotools base
DESCRIPTION="A library to encapsulate CD-ROM reading and control"
HOMEPAGE="http://www.gnu.org/software/libcdio/"
@@ -21,15 +21,18 @@ DEPEND="${RDEPEND}
sys-devel/gettext
dev-util/pkgconfig"
-src_unpack() {
- unpack ${A}
- cd "${S}"
+PATCHES=(
+ "${FILESDIR}"/${PN}-0.80-automagic-cddb.patch
+)
+DOCS=( AUTHORS ChangeLog NEWS README THANKS )
- eautomake
+src_prepare() {
+ base_src_prepare
+ eautoreconf
elibtoolize
}
-src_compile() {
+src_configure() {
econf \
$(use_enable cddb) \
$(use_with !minimal cd-drive) \
@@ -44,13 +47,7 @@ src_compile() {
--with-cd-paranoia-name=libcdio-paranoia \
--disable-vcd-info \
--disable-dependency-tracking \
- --disable-maintainer-mode || die "configure failed"
- emake || die "make failed"
-}
-
-src_install() {
- emake DESTDIR="${D}" install || die "make install failed"
- dodoc AUTHORS ChangeLog NEWS README THANKS
+ --disable-maintainer-mode
}
pkg_postinst() {